This Virginia Business article examines proposed amendments to Virginia’s adult-use cannabis legislation, including moving the start of retail sales to July 2027 and reducing the number of available store licenses. Tanner Johnson discusses the trade-offs for local businesses, noting that a longer implementation period could provide more time to prepare while also delaying consumer access to a safe and regulated market. The story highlights the importance of creating a competitive framework that gives Virginia-based businesses a realistic opportunity to participate.
